Best Practices for Prompt Optimization
- Be Clear and Specific: Clearly define what you want the AI to do. Vague prompts can lead to irrelevant or incorrect responses.
- Use Context Effectively: Provide necessary background information to help the AI understand the task better.
- Limit the Scope: Narrow down the prompt to focus on specific aspects rather than broad topics.
- Iterate and Refine: Test different versions of your prompts and refine them based on the responses received.
- Incorporate Examples: Including examples can guide the AI towards the desired output style and content.
- Set Constraints: Specify constraints such as word limits or format requirements to streamline responses.
Techniques to Enhance Speed and Precision
Several techniques can be employed to improve prompt effectiveness:
- Use Structured Prompts: Employ templates or structured formats to guide the AI systematically.
- Leverage Few-Shot Learning: Provide a few examples within the prompt to demonstrate the expected output.
- Adjust Temperature Settings: Fine-tune AI parameters to balance creativity and accuracy.
- Implement Feedback Loops: Continuously evaluate responses and adjust prompts accordingly.
- Utilize Prompt Engineering Tools: Use specialized tools or plugins designed to optimize prompt formulation.
Common Mistakes to Avoid
- Being Too Vague: Ambiguous prompts lead to inconsistent results.
- Overloading Prompts: Excessive information can confuse the AI and reduce response quality.
- Ignoring Context: Failing to provide necessary background hampers understanding.
- Neglecting Iteration: Not refining prompts can prevent achieving optimal outputs.
- Using Unclear Constraints: Vague instructions about format or length can cause undesired responses.
